Administrator-triggered state changes and unexpected failures
Published Sep 12, 2022 · Updated Sep 16, 2024
Unchecked return handling in Dell Client Platform BIOS on pre-21Q4 platforms allows local users to alter system state or trigger failures. Dell has not published the affected firmware routine, the unchecked operation, or the return value that is ignored. Exploitation requires local authenticated administrator privileges and high attack complexity; reported consequences are system-state changes and unexpected failures.
